Despierta America Hosts a Special Event for "Alvin and the Chipmunks: Chipwrecked"

by EAStaff | December 16, 2011

Karla Martinez and Poncho de Anda hosts of the morning show, Despierta America hosted a special advance screening of the upcoming film ALVIN AND THE CHIPMUNKS: CHIPWRECKED for children from the non-for profit organization Youth Co-Op. This is the third installment of the Alvin and the Chipmunks franchise from 20th Century Fox and will hit theaters this Friday, December 16, 2011.

More than 60 children from Youth Co-Op met the famous Chipmunks: Alvin, Simon and Theodore, who presented the film and posed for photos at the Cobb theater at Dolphin Mall (Miami, FL). Everyone was thrilled to see Alvin, Simon and Theodore in person and share in this memorable holiday experience.

About ALVIN AND THE CHIPMUNKS: CHIPWRECKED
On vacation aboard a luxury cruise ship, Alvin, Simon, Theodore and the Chipettes are up to their usual antics, turning the ship into their personal playground, until they become ‘chipwrecked’ on a desert island. As Dave Seville frantically searches for his AWOL charges, the ‘Munks and Chipettes’ do what they do best – sing, dance and wreak havoc. But they’re in for the biggest surprises and lessons of their lives when they embark on an island adventure with their new friend – a castaway who’s more than a match for Alvin and the Chipmunks.
